AI-READI Yearlong Research Internship Program

Abstract

The AI Ready and Equitable Atlas for Diabetes Insights (AI-READI) program offers a unique yearlong mentored research experience in data science and biomedical research. Funded by NIH through the Bridge to Artificial Intelligence (Bridge2AI) program, this paid internship provides monthly stipends ranging from $2,200-$5,500 and comprehensive training in AI applications for diabetes research.

Program Overview

The AI-READI Yearlong Research Internship Program represents a groundbreaking initiative funded by the National Institutes of Health (NIH) through the Bridge to Artificial Intelligence (Bridge2AI) program. This comprehensive program is designed to develop the next generation of researchers skilled in applying AI and data science to critical biomedical challenges, with a specific focus on diabetes insights.

Key Program Features

Financial Support

  • Paid internship with monthly stipends ranging from $2,200 to $5,500
  • Full-time commitment required
  • Travel support for bootcamp attendance

Program Structure

Summer Bootcamp (2 weeks)

  • Intensive hands-on programming instruction at UC San Diego
  • Introduction to machine learning and AI concepts
  • Research ethics workshops
  • Team building and networking opportunities

Year-Long Research Project

  • Mentored research at participating sites across the country
  • Monthly journal clubs and lectures
  • Topics include:
    • Machine learning applications in healthcare
    • Data models and analysis
    • Grant writing skills
    • Career development

Culminating Symposium

  • Year-end research presentation
  • Networking with leading researchers
  • Career advancement opportunities

Eligibility Requirements

  • Minimum undergraduate degree in a relevant field
  • Full-time commitment to the program
  • Strong technical and quantitative skills
  • Must be physically located in the United States
  • Required application materials:
    • Personal statement
    • Two letters of recommendation
    • Academic transcripts

Research Focus

Participants will engage in cutting-edge research projects involving:

  • AI applications for diabetes prediction and management
  • Large-scale data analysis of diabetic patient outcomes
  • Development of equitable AI models for diverse populations
  • Creation of research-ready datasets for the broader scientific community
